Description
🎯 Problem to be solved:
The current documentation for setting up monitoring for the Alpha Cluster lacks specific details needed to guide our users effectively. The missing information includes correct flags for the Charon cluster, the Charon cluster node, the relay node, methods to check block authorship, troubleshoot block authorship, and check good peer connectivity.
🛠️ Proposed solution:
The team should review the current documentation and add details regarding:
- Correct flags for the Charon cluster
- Correct flags for the Charon cluster node
- Correct flags for the relay node
- Methodology to check block authorship
- Troubleshooting guide for block authorship (including how to check if a block misses duty)
- Procedure to check good peer connectivity
With these additions, we can ensure our users have a comprehensive guide to setting up monitoring for the Alpha Cluster.
